本文目录导读:
随着大数据时代的到来,数据交易市场逐渐兴起,各类数据交易网站应运而生,对于大多数企业和个人而言,如何构建一个高效、安全、合规的数据交易平台仍然是一个难题,本文将深入剖析数据交易网站源码,揭示其构建核心,为广大读者提供有益的参考。
数据交易网站源码概述
数据交易网站源码是指一个数据交易平台所使用的程序代码,包括前端界面、后端逻辑、数据库设计等,一个优秀的数据交易网站源码应具备以下特点:
1、开源:便于用户研究、学习和改进,提高平台的性能和安全性。
2、高效:能够快速响应用户请求,提高用户体验。
图片来源于网络,如有侵权联系删除
3、安全:保护用户隐私和数据安全,防止数据泄露和恶意攻击。
4、易于扩展:适应市场需求,满足不同类型的数据交易需求。
5、合规:符合国家相关法律法规,保障平台合规运营。
数据交易网站源码构建核心
1、前端界面
数据交易网站的前端界面是用户与平台交互的第一步,其设计应简洁、美观、易用,以下为前端界面构建的核心要素:
(1)框架选择:目前主流的前端框架有Vue.js、React、Angular等,根据项目需求和团队熟悉程度选择合适的框架。
(2)界面布局:采用响应式设计,确保在不同设备上均有良好展示。
(3)组件开发:使用组件化开发,提高代码复用性和可维护性。
(4)交互体验:优化交互效果,提升用户体验。
2、后端逻辑
图片来源于网络,如有侵权联系删除
数据交易网站的后端逻辑是整个平台的核心,负责处理用户请求、数据存储、业务逻辑等,以下为后端逻辑构建的核心要素:
(1)框架选择:常见的后端框架有Spring Boot、Django、Express等,根据项目需求和团队熟悉程度选择合适的框架。
(2)数据库设计:采用关系型数据库(如MySQL、Oracle)或非关系型数据库(如MongoDB、Redis),根据数据特点选择合适的数据库类型。
(3)业务逻辑:实现数据上传、下载、交易、支付等功能,确保业务流程的顺利进行。
(4)安全防护:采用HTTPS、验证码、权限控制等手段,保障用户数据安全。
3、数据库设计
数据库是数据交易网站的核心组成部分,其设计应满足以下要求:
(1)数据模型:根据业务需求设计合理的实体关系,确保数据完整性。
(2)索引优化:针对查询频繁的字段建立索引,提高查询效率。
(3)数据迁移:支持数据迁移,便于平台升级和扩展。
图片来源于网络,如有侵权联系删除
4、安全性设计
数据交易网站的安全性设计至关重要,以下为安全性设计的关键点:
(1)数据加密:对敏感数据进行加密存储和传输,防止数据泄露。
(2)权限控制:实现用户权限分级,确保用户只能访问授权数据。
(3)防攻击措施:采用防火墙、入侵检测系统等手段,防止恶意攻击。
(4)安全审计:记录用户操作日志,便于追踪和审计。
数据交易网站源码的构建是一个复杂的过程,需要充分考虑前端界面、后端逻辑、数据库设计、安全性设计等多个方面,通过深入剖析数据交易网站源码,我们可以了解到构建一个高效、安全、合规的数据交易平台的核心要素,希望本文能为广大读者提供有益的参考,助力数据交易市场的繁荣发展。
标签: #数据交易网站源码
评论列表